What to expect at a service at Bethany Baptist Church


Baptist churches emphasize Scripture, a clear gospel message, and music — and welcome visitors to observe freely.

  • Services usually run 60–90 minutes: worship songs, a Bible-centered sermon, and an invitation to respond.
  • Communion (called the Lord's Supper) is observed periodically, open to anyone who has professed faith in Christ.
  • Dress is casual; families are welcomed and children are often part of the service.
